Whether basketball is your game or you’re looking to improve your agility and hand-eye coordination, this drill is sure to help. Start by standing up with the basketball cradled between your legs, having one hand in front and the other behind. Next, switch places rapidly and try your best to keep the basketball from touching the floor. Do this for 12 reps as fast as you can for an effective basketball dribbling drill to increase your athleticism. With quick hands and a few tries, you’ll be ready to show off your basketball finesse!
